    What is a Fairy Garden?

    A fairy garden is a miniature garden made with small plants and flowers and miniature structures. These DIY Fairy gardens can contain tiny houses and all kinds of magical items for a fairy to live.

    To make a great dollar tree fairy garden, one trip to the craft store, garden center, and or dollar tree, and you will be set. You can find some dollar store fairy garden ideas finding whimsical figurines and lots of dollar tree items in the gardening section.

    The fun thing is that the dollar tree is a great place to put your own spin on your garden scene. If you are looking for river rocks, or popsicle sticks to make into welcome signs, there are so many fun craft supplies to make your enchanted garden come to life.

    What You Need For Dollar Tree Fairy Garden

    I've decided to also add a walk-through version here as well in case you missed anything on the video. Here is how you make it:

    Fairy Garden Supplies:

    How to make a Fairy Garden | Fairy Garden Tutorial | Dollar Store Fairy Garden | Summer Activities for Kids | Spring Gardening with Kids | www.madewithHAPPY.com

    • Buckets, clay pots, bowls, flower pots, terra cotta pots, or wide-mouth pots - Like this one
    • Soil
    • Flowers
    • Small Plants
    • Rocks or floral marbles
    • Fairy House
    • Floral decorations (birds, butterflies, mushrooms, etc.)
    • Fairy

    How to Make a Fairy Garden

    Start by making sure there are holes in the bottom of your bowl. If there are no holes, then use a drill and drill two small holes.

    Next, fill the bucket with soil. Leave some room on the top for the garden decorations. You never want to fill to the very top so that your water doesn't overflow from the top.

    Plant the flowers around the bucket. I love the idea of a slightly larger one in the back and then flowers around the that, but really it is however the kids want to make it.

    Next have the kids place all their decorations around the bucket.

    The last step is to add rocks or marbles around the flowers and decorations.
